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- .NET

Страница: 1 |

 

  Вопрос: как сделать селект в таблице Добавлено: 24.01.08 11:29  

Автор вопроса:  ВанCone
есть таблица (Созданная в SQL), в ней есть строчки, есть кнопа. Надо что бы при нажатии на кнопку выделенная строчка обрабатывалась(ну не важно что делала, хоть писалось бы сообщение, в которое вносилось бы значение выделенной строчки)

Ответить

  Ответы Всего ответов: 3  

Номер ответа: 1
Автор ответа:
 Павел



Вопросов: 0
Ответов: 1
 Профиль | | #1 Добавлено: 25.01.08 13:40
а как ты выодишь таблицу если например через gridview то тут просто данные из этой строки можно получить следующим способом:

 Protected Sub GridView1_SelectedIndexChanged(ByVal sender As Object, ByVal e As System.EventArgs) Handles GridView1.SelectedIndexChanged
        idtxt.Text = Convert.ToString(GridView1.SelectedRow.Cells(1).Text)
            End Sub

Ответить

Номер ответа: 2
Автор ответа:
 BUMM ®



Вопросов: 8
Ответов: 482
 Профиль | | #2 Добавлено: 25.01.08 23:50

есть таблица (Созданная в SQL), в ней есть строчки, есть кнопа

оччень обьективно :/

Convert.ToString(GridView1.SelectedRow.Cells(1).Text)


а может
Convert.ToString(DataGridView1.SelectedRows(0).Cells(1).Value)


и вообще зачем обрабатывать событие SelectedIndexChanged

если Т.С. говорит про кнопку

Ответить

Номер ответа: 3
Автор ответа:
 Fatty



Вопросов: 0
Ответов: 55
 Профиль | | #3 Добавлено: 26.01.08 13:36
Как вариант:

    Private Sub DataGridView1_DoubleClick(ByVal sender As Object, ByVal e As System.EventArgs) Handles DataGridView1.DoubleClick
        Dim rcol As [Object] = DataGridView1.SelectedRows(0).Cells
        Dim ar As ArrayList = New ArrayList
        ar.AddRange(rcol)
        For Each v As Object In ar
            MessageBox.Show(v.Value.ToString)
        Next
    End Sub


~'J'~

Ответить

Страница: 1 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ам